    The Montreal Impact logo combines European football elegance with Quebec’s distinctive fleur-de-lis symbolism, creating a badge that feels both internationally credible and authentically Montrealais. The predominantly blue and silver palette projects sophistication appropriate for Canada’s francophone metropolis.

    The shield badge features a prominent fleur-de-lis rendered in a contemporary, geometric style that honors Quebec’s French heritage without appearing antiquated. This symbol provides immediate cultural connection while speaking the visual language of global football. The navy blue and silver palette creates a refined, almost corporate sophistication that distinguishes the Impact from more aggressive North American sports aesthetics. Strategic use of multiple blue and gray tones adds depth and allows for flexible applications across diverse contexts.

    The logo’s composition demonstrates how regional symbolism can be adapted for contemporary sports branding. The fleur-de-lis dominates the shield without overwhelming it, surrounded by enough breathing room to maintain clarity at all scales. Four stars positioned above the symbol reference the club’s pre-MLS championships, adding heritage and credibility to a franchise transitioning to top-tier competition. This combination of traditional symbolism and modern execution creates a mark that resonates with Montreal’s unique cultural position.

    Meaning and Symbolism

    • The fleur-de-lis represents Quebec’s French heritage and Montreal’s distinct cultural identity
    • Navy blue communicates tradition, professionalism, and European football credibility
    • Silver adds sophistication and modernity, elevating the palette beyond typical sports colors
    • Four stars honor the club’s NASL championships and establish historical continuity
    • The shield format connects to European football tradition while providing stable badge structure

    Design and History

    Montreal Impact joined MLS in 2012 as the league’s third Canadian franchise, inheriting a legacy from lower-division predecessors that had established the fleur-de-lis as central to the club’s identity. The MLS logo evolution refined this symbol for larger-scale professional operations while maintaining the cultural connection essential to Montreal’s francophone market. The design team recognized that the fleur-de-lis provided authentic differentiation within North American soccer while resonating with European football aesthetics familiar to Montreal’s diverse, internationally-minded population.

    The predominantly blue and silver palette proved strategic in distinguishing the Impact from Toronto FC’s red and white while creating visual kinship with European clubs. This color choice also connects to Montreal’s historic Blue, Blanc, Rouge hockey culture while establishing a more sophisticated visual tone appropriate for soccer’s international character. The refined execution positions the Impact as a credible participant in global football culture rather than a provincial North American franchise.

    Typography

    The Montreal Impact wordmark employs clean, modern letterforms with European proportions that complement the logo’s refined aesthetic. The typography maintains excellent legibility while projecting the sophistication and international credibility central to the brand’s positioning within Montreal’s cosmopolitan market.

    FAQ

    Q: Why is the fleur-de-lis central to the Impact logo? A: The fleur-de-lis is Quebec’s most recognizable symbol, representing the region’s French heritage and distinct cultural identity. It provides authentic local connection while working within global football visual conventions.

    Q: What do the four stars represent? A: The stars honor the club’s four NASL championships won before joining MLS, establishing historical continuity and credibility for a franchise entering top-tier competition.

    Q: How does the logo reflect Montreal’s character? A: The sophisticated blue and silver palette, combined with the refined fleur-de-lis treatment, captures Montreal’s cosmopolitan European character while honoring its Quebec identity. It balances local authenticity with international credibility.

    Why is the Montreal Impact logo in SVG format?
    The Montreal Impact logo is provided as an SVG (Scalable Vector Graphics) file because vectors offer unlimited scaling without pixelation, smaller file sizes than raster images, and are ideal for responsive web design. SVG logos work perfectly across all screen sizes — from mobile devices to billboard prints — maintaining crisp edges at any resolution.
    Should I use SVG or PNG for the Montreal Impact logo?
    Use SVG for websites, apps, and any digital design requiring scalability. SVG files are resolution-independent and load faster. Use PNG (converted from SVG at 300 DPI) for presentations, printed materials, or software that doesn’t support SVG. Convert using Adobe Illustrator, Inkscape, Affinity Designer, or online tools like CloudConvert. Export at 300 DPI for print, 72-150 DPI for web.
    What software can open the Montreal Impact SVG logo?
    The Montreal Impact SVG logo opens in both code editors (VS Code, Sublime Text, Notepad++) and graphic design software (Figma, Adobe Illustrator, Affinity Designer, Sketch, Inkscape). Modern web browsers can also display SVG files directly. For quick edits, online editors like SVGEdit or Method Draw work without installing software.
